Abstract

New stable [6,6]-closed cycloadducts, fulleropyrazolines containing aryl, hetaryl, trifluoromethyl, and other substituents in the five-membered ring, have been obtained by the 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ition of nitrile imines to C60. Two methods of generating nitrile imines in situ have been used, the dehydrohalogenation of the corresponding hydrazonoyl halides by the action of triethylamine and the thermal decomposition of 2,5-diaryltetrazoles.
